The intrinsic value of First Asset's stock can be calculated using various methods such as discounted cash flow analysis, price-to-earnings ratio, or price-to-book ratio. That value may differ from its current market price, which is determined by supply and demand factors such as investor sentiment, market trends, news, and other external factors that may influence First Asset's stock price. It is important to note that the real value of any stock may change over time based on changes in the company's performance.

About First Asset Valuation
We use absolute and relative valuation methodologies to arrive at the intrinsic value of First Asset Tech. In general, an absolute valuation paradigm, as applied to this etf, attempts to find the value of First Asset Tech based exclusively on its fundamental and basic technical indicators. By analyzing First Asset's financials, quarterly and monthly indicators, and their related drivers, we attempt to find the most accurate representation of First Asset's intrinsic value. As compared to an absolute model, our relative valuation model uses a comparative analysis of First Asset. We calculate exposure to First Asset's market risk, different technical and fundamental indicators, and relevant financial multiples and ratios and then compare them to those of First Asset's related companies.The investment objective of the Tech ETF is to provide Unitholders, through an actively managed portfolio, as described below, with quarterly cash distributions, the opportunity for capital appreciation by investing on an equal weight basis in a portfolio of securities of the 25 largest Technology Companies measured by market capitalization listed on a North American stock exchange and lower overall volatility of returns on the portfolio than would be experienced by owning a portfolio of securities of such issuers directly. CI FA is traded on Toronto Stock Exchange in Canada.
